Part Time Faculty Interest Pool - Psychology
Portland Community College is accepting applications to be considered for Part-Time Faculty assignments in Psychology. The Department will review applications in this pool as the need arises for new part-time faculty in this area.
This is NOT an announcement of a specific open position, but a Part-time Faculty Interest Pool, from which the department will identify applicants based on course assignment needs during the Academic Year. Your application may be considered for substitute assignments as well as full term class assignments.

Instructor Qualifications
- Master's degree, or higher, in Psychology (including all specialized degree with Psychology in the title of the degree)
- OR
- Master's degree, or higher, in Counseling (including specialties in MFT, MFCC, CMF)
- OR
- Master's degree, or higher, in a Related Area
- Completion of 30 quarter-hours of graduate credit in a Psychology or Counseling Department
Related Area degree include, but are not limited to:
- Cognitive Science, Human Science, Neuroscience
- Social or Human Ecology, Social Work, Human Development
Qualifications for PSY 236 (Psychology of Adult Development & Aging) Course:
- Meet general instructor qualifications for Psychology (above) OR
- Master's degree in Gerontology
- At least 30 graduate credit hours in Psychology and/or Human Development
Note Regarding Academic Credentials
- Official transcripts are required to be submitted within 2 weeks of offer date for degrees required in the stated Instructor Qualifications.
- Instructors shall have earned required academic credentials at a regionally accredited US institution or a foreign institution having the equivalent of regional accreditation.

Part-time Faculty Compensation at PCC
Newly hired Part-time Faculty at PCC will generally start at Step 1 of the current salary schedule.
Hourly rates are determine based upon the type of course taught (Lecture, Lab, or Lecture/Lab).
